Vets take opener

NEW ULM - The Weimar Vets traveled to New Ulm to take on the Firemen for their first game of the community lease 2025 season.

The Vets came out on top 3-1 in a tightly contested game for the whole nine innings.

Trevor Brown started on the mound for three and one third strong innings allowing no runs and only one hit while striking out four. In relief, Huxton Kloesel threw five and two thirds strong innings, shutting down the New Ulm hitters allowing only four hits, one walk, and striking out six for the win.

A great defensive performance with no errors kept New Ulm from scoring more with 10 run- ners left on base.

Defensive standouts included

Carson Peschel, Emerson Harvey, Jeff Osburn, Cody Barrett, Ryan Rerich, and Kyle Peschel behind the plate for all nine in- nings.

Offensive leaders included Carson Peschel- 2 BB, run scored, 2-SB; Cody Barrett- run scored, BB; Kyle Peschel- 2 sin -

gles, RBI, 2-SB; Weston Pavlik- RBI, 2-BB; Ryan Rerich- HBP,

run scored; Trevor Brown- HBP, single, BB.
